Texas Woman Gets Year in Prison for Crashing Weddings

SAN ANTONIO — A 31-year-old San Antonio woman was sentenced Friday to a year in federal prison for crashing weddings and stealing credit cards from the wedding participants while the couple said their vows.

Robin Neafie pleaded guilty to federal access device charges in April and was sentenced in U.S. District Court on Friday.

Prosecutors said she found weddings by looking through newspaper announcements or local church listings and then showing up well-dressed for an event.

While the ceremony was going on, authorities said she rifled through wallets and purses left unattended by wedding party members.

Prosecutors said Neafie continued the scheme for four years before being caught in June 2006 after victims reported unauthorized charges.
